Things to Do around Gortmacrane

Gortmacrane is a townland located within County Londonderry, Ireland. This area is characterized by its position within a region offering diverse landscapes, including coastal paths, river valleys, and the rolling hills of the Sperrin Mountains. The varied terrain provides opportunities for several outdoor sports, such as hiking, road cycling, jogging, and touring cycling.

What natural features are near Gortmacrane?

The broader County Londonderry region, where Gortmacrane is located, features diverse natural beauty. This includes Roe Valley Country Park, Ness Country Park with Northern Ireland's highest waterfall, and the Sperrin Mountains,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.
